Which pulley turns fastest?

In a pulley system, the smallest pulley usually turns fastest because it requires more revolutions to navigate the same length of the belt. Pulleys of Different or Same Size If two pulleys of the same size are connected by a belt, as one turns, the second one will turn at the same speed with the same power available at the shaft. Do pulleys increase horsepower?

When you use an underdrive pulley, you can make major horsepower gains. Because they replace stock water pumps, power steering, AC units and alternators, you may even notice increased acceleration when you choose an underdrive pulley. Horsepower gains from underdrive pulleys can vary by vehicle, engine, number of accessories and the amount of underdrive (improvements of up to 5–15 HP at the wheels have been seen). Additional and significant performance improvements can be seen by reducing the weight of the pulley versus the original pulley.
